A race car goes around a level, circular track with a diameter of 1.00 km at a constant speed of 101 km/h. What is the car's centripetal acceleration in m/s2? answer in:___m/s2

Answer :

We can find the centripetal acceleration as follows:

[tex]\begin{gathered} a_c=\frac{v^2}{r} \\ where: \\ v=101km/h=28.0556m/s \\ r=\frac{diameter}{2}=\frac{1000m}{2}=500m \\ so: \\ a_c=\frac{(28.0556^2)}{500}=1.5742m/s^2 \end{gathered}[/tex]

Answer:

1.5742 m/s²
